    I am under the impression the nostalgia for TBC was in large due to how back then things weren't handed to you in endgame progression right away, you actually had to progress through 5 man normals, heroics, one raid after the other in the progression chain, including attunement quests and so on. Overall, endgame content was much more comprised of interlocking parts forming a complex system, and less the streamlined, one could say "dumbed down" approach seen in later expansions (just compare TBC and WotLK heroic dungeons, where the former were actual meaningful non-faceroll parts of endgame progression).

    For that reason, adding shop would be a horrible idea in my opinion, as it would take out much of the charm of TBC content, and as much as I see, most commenters here share that opinion.

    Personally, I would also prefer fully Blizzlike rates, or at most something like 2x, possibly somewhat sped up after the first character -- though leveling up alts to 70 wouldn't nearly be as much of a chore as say, 100 without boosting options (hence the surge in level boosting possibilities in later expansions in retail WoW). All the work that goes into making these quests that are showcased in the post would be wasted on 5x rates. If you are a newer player, or trying out a new class, having to do dungeons while leveling also teaches a lot, gradually.
